# [3.0.0](https://github.com/revanced/revanced-patcher/compare/v2.9.0...v3.0.0) (2022-08-02)

### Features

* registry for patch options ([2431785](2431785d0e))

### BREAKING CHANGES

* Patch options now use the PatchOptions registry class instead of an Iterable. This change requires modifications to existing patches using this API.

package app.revanced.patcher.patch
@Suppress("CanBeParameter", "MemberVisibilityCanBePrivate")
class NoSuchOptionException(val option: String) : Exception("No such option: $option")
/**
* A registry for an array of [PatchOption]s.
* @param options An array of [PatchOption]s.
*/
@Suppress("MemberVisibilityCanBePrivate")
class PatchOptions(vararg val options: PatchOption<*>) : Iterable<PatchOption<*>> {
private val register = buildMap {
for (option in options) {
if (containsKey(option.key)) {
throw IllegalStateException("Multiple options found with the same key")
}
put(option.key, option)
}
}
/**
* Get a [PatchOption] by its key.
* @param key The key of the [PatchOption].
*/
operator fun get(key: String) = register[key] ?: throw NoSuchOptionException(key)
/**
* Set the value of a [PatchOption].
* @param key The key of the [PatchOption].
* @param value The value you want it to be.
* Please note that using the wrong value type results in a runtime error.
*/
inline operator fun <reified T> set(key: String, value: T) {
@Suppress("UNCHECKED_CAST") val opt = get(key) as? PatchOption<T>
if (opt == null || opt.value !is T) throw IllegalArgumentException(
"The type of the option value is not the same as the type value provided"
)
opt.value = value
}
override fun iterator() = options.iterator()
}
